Steph McDougal, MTSC, MSHP, PhD

Historic preservation consultant

Steph McDougal is a preservation consultant and the Principal Consultant at McDoux Preservation LLC, a specialized preservation consulting firm that provides research-based solutions for city governments, non-profit preservation organizations, and individuals. With a background in sales/marketing and training/education, McDougal has developed training and performance systems for Global 500 companies, small businesses, higher education, and non-profits since 1996. She completed a Master's degree in Historic Preservation in 2008 and refocused her existing consulting practice. McDoux Preservation specializes in long-range planning, community engagement, and program development/evaluation, and provides design guidelines, ordinance development, and strategic planning with an integrated action/reporting component. McDougal also holds a Master's degree in Technical & Scientific Communication with a focus on instructional design. Prior to her career in preservation consulting, McDougal worked for Lion Apparel, The Iams Company, Sinclair Community College/University of Dayton, Ohio, and the Center for Chemical Education/Miami University Middletown (Ohio). She has also served as an adjunct assistant professor at the University of Cincinnati, and as founder, Board of Directors (Past President) and Secretary at Texas Dance Hall Preservation, Inc. McDougal is currently pursuing short-term and long-term contracts on a project basis. She is headquartered in the greater Houston area and works with clients throughout Texas and the United States.
